I doubt we'll see many, or any, more martial classes.

With 8 power sources x 4 (give or take) classes each, thats already 32 classes. They have to be careful to make each class distinct, with a unique shtick. I don't think there is enough design space to make too many more Martial classes, especially when you consider that other power sources are going to have 'melee' classes (Barbarian - primal, likely Warden - primal, Swordmage - Arcane).

At best, I think we might see more builds for existing classes, and more powers for existing classes (as long as they don't overlap with other classes' powers). Paragon Paths and Epic Destinies, since they are very specific, have more design space.

I'm in favour of fewer classes...seems like there is little need for many of the 3.5 classes, as they are only slight variations on existing classes. I'd rather just see more build options.
